3,000 kg heroin seized in Gujarat exposes Taliban’s drug nexus
.Almost a month after the Taliban took control of Afghanistan, 3,000 kilograms of banned narcotics — heroin, was seized by the Indian law enforcement agencies at Gujarat’s Mundra Port. The investigators estimate that the drugs seized are worth Rs 21,000 crore in the international market and were shipped from Afghanistan
The development raised a serious question about Taliban’s promise to stop drug production and its trade using the soil of Afghanistan.
After taking control of Afghanistan, Taliban spokesperson Zabihullah Mujahid on August 18 told the media in Kabul that his government was committed to stop the production of narcotics in the country.
“We want to assure our people and the international community that we will not allow the production of any narcotics. From this moment, nobody is allowed in any heroin trade or drug smuggling from Afghanistan,” Zabihullah Mujahid had said.
However, within a month, 3 tonnes of high-quality heroin, originating from Taliban-led Afghanistan, in two consignments reached Gujarat disguised as Talc stone.
